Man charged in slaying draws $775,000 bond

6/4/2014
BLADE STAFF

Bond was set at $775,000 on Tuesday for a Springfield Township man charged in the fatal stabbing of a 72-year-old woman with whom he had been living.

Adam Akers, 41, of 7519 Dorr St. appeared before Lucas County Common Pleas Judge Myron Duhart, who continued his arraignment until next Tuesday at the request of defense attorney Ronnie Wingate.

Mr. Akers is charged with murder and felonious assault for the May 14 death of Judith Uyttenhove, who was stabbed 13 times with a kitchen knife. Investigators said he had recently moved into her Royal Village mobile home.
